Civray is a charming historic market town in the Vienne region, known for its relaxed atmosphere, Romanesque architecture, weekly markets, and scenic riverside surroundings. The town offers cultural heritage, local traditions, and peaceful walking areas, making it a pleasant stop for travelers exploring rural France.

What to See & Do

  • ⛪ Romanesque Church: Visit the stunning Church of Saint-Nicolas 🏛️ with detailed stone carvings 🗿
  • 🛍️ Weekly Market: Explore fresh produce, crafts 🧺 and local foods on Tuesdays and Fridays 🥦
  • 🌊 Riverside Walks: Enjoy peaceful strolls 🚶 along the Charente River 🛶
  • 🏘️ Old Town: Wander through historic streets 🛤️ and quiet squares ⛲
  • 🥐 Local Shops: Discover bakeries, cafés ☕ and small boutiques 👗

How to Get There

  • 🚗 By Car: 55 minutes from Poitiers 📍 45 minutes from Angoulême 🏁
  • 🚆 By Train: Nearest major stations 🚉 Poitiers or Ruffec, then taxi 🚕
  • 🚌 By Bus: Limited regional bus 🚐 routes available 🗺️
